![]() As I was eating breakfast this morning, I opened my computer and started working. I had 6 windows open, my phone beside me, and my to-do list staring me down, I was in full multitask when a voice started sending me some very tempting messages. "You should go spend some time in the garden." "You should go walk in the woods." "You should go do a few sun salutations." These are things of course I love doing, but I had too much to do. I thought, "I'll do them later." But as you may know, "later" doesn't always come. I had a thought about what was actually important on my list, and why is it that those things I love to do, don't even get on the list. Even if it's finding a quiet spot to breathe for 3 minutes, items like this should not only be on the list, they should be at the top. Just being still may seem unproductive, but if it brings you focus, calmness, and clarity, how much more productive will the rest of your day be? The most important thing we can do, is nourish ourselves first.
